Over the past few months I think we have all managed to perfect a few recipes, and I think or most this has been some form of banana Muffins. So I thought I would share my muffin recipe:
250g plain flower
1t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p bicarbonate of soda
110 g sugar
75g butter – melted
1tsp vanilla extract
2 eggs
2 ripe bananas
1 1/2 tsp mixed spices(or cinnamon and nutmeg)
125ml Milk

Lets Get Baking
- Pre-heat the oven to 180C fan assisted
- Mash the ripe banana in a large mixing bowl
- Add the vanilla extract, melted butter, eggs and milk mix thoroughly
- Combine your flour, baking powder, bicarbonate of soda and mixed spices with the wet ingredients.
- Evenly distribute to the 12 muffin tray
- Pop in the oven for 18-25 minutes.
Allow to cool and then enjoy!
